After a week and a half we were finally on our way to South America!! We arrived in Sao Paulo full of excitment and happiness to have finally made it, only to discover that we had arrived in a giant Ghetto. To Sao Paulos credit, it was the middle of the night and we were staying in possibly one of the worst areas in the city (Thanks STA) so perhaps this hindered upon our views of the city. We only had one day in the city, and after being ripped off and forced to pay 100 dollars by a scary taxi driver it is fair to say we were ready to leave. Here are a few photos from the view of our hotel and from the safety of our taxi on our way out of the city, as we were too scared to take the camera out at any other time! We have since been told that the area we stayed in and the places we visited were not the main tourist areas and that there are infact some very nice areas. Perhaps we will venture back one day and check them out.
